
在Excel中删除日期的几种方法包括:直接删除单元格内容、使用查找和替换功能、利用文本到列功能。下面将详细介绍其中一种方法,即直接删除单元格内容。
直接删除单元格内容是最常见也是最简单的方法之一。只需要选择包含日期的单元格或区域,然后按键盘上的"Delete"键即可。这种方法适用于删除少量日期数据。但如果需要处理大量日期数据或希望保留单元格格式,还有其他方法可以考虑。
一、直接删除单元格内容
1、选择单元格或区域
首先,打开包含日期的Excel工作表。使用鼠标或键盘选择需要删除日期的单元格或区域。你可以单击单元格并拖动鼠标选择多个单元格,或使用Shift键加方向键选择连续的单元格。
2、按"Delete"键
选择好单元格后,按键盘上的"Delete"键,单元格中的日期将被删除,单元格内容变为空白。此方法非常直观,适用于删除少量数据。
二、使用查找和替换功能
1、打开查找和替换对话框
在Excel中,按"Ctrl + H"快捷键打开查找和替换对话框。在查找内容框中输入你要删除的日期格式,例如"yyyy/mm/dd"或"mm/dd/yyyy"等。请确保输入的格式与单元格中的日期格式一致。
2、替换为空白
在替换为框中留空,点击"全部替换"按钮。Excel将会搜索整个工作表并将符合条件的日期替换为空白单元格。此方法适用于删除特定格式的日期。
三、利用文本到列功能
1、选择包含日期的列
选择包含日期的整个列或区域。然后点击Excel菜单栏中的"数据"选项卡,找到"文本到列"功能并点击。
2、设置文本到列选项
在文本到列向导中,选择“分隔符号”,点击“下一步”。在分隔符选项中,确保所有选项都未勾选,然后点击“完成”。此时,选定的列中所有日期将被移除,只剩下文本内容。
四、使用公式删除日期
1、创建新列
在原数据旁边创建一个新列,用于存放删除日期后的数据。假设原数据在A列,新列在B列。
2、使用公式
在B列的第一个单元格输入公式=IF(ISNUMBER(A1),"",A1),然后按Enter键。此公式用于判断A列中的单元格是否为日期格式,如果是,则返回空白,否则返回原数据。
3、填充公式
选择B列第一个单元格,将公式向下填充至整个列。此时,B列将显示删除日期后的数据。
五、使用VBA宏删除日期
1、打开VBA编辑器
按"Alt + F11"打开VBA编辑器。在VBA编辑器中,选择插入->模块,插入一个新模块。
2、输入VBA代码
在新模块中输入以下VBA代码:
Sub DeleteDates()
Dim cell As Range
For Each cell In Selection
If IsDate(cell.Value) Then
cell.ClearContents
End If
Next cell
End Sub
3、运行宏
返回Excel工作表,选择包含日期的单元格区域。然后按"Alt + F8"打开宏对话框,选择"DeleteDates"宏并点击“运行”。此时,选定区域中的所有日期将被删除。
六、使用筛选功能删除日期
1、启用筛选
选择包含日期的列或区域,点击Excel菜单栏中的“数据”选项卡,然后点击“筛选”按钮启用筛选功能。
2、筛选日期
点击列标题旁边的筛选箭头,选择“日期筛选”选项,然后选择“全部日期”或特定日期范围。此时,工作表中将只显示符合条件的日期。
3、删除筛选结果
选择显示的筛选结果,按“Delete”键删除内容。最后,关闭筛选功能,工作表中所有符合条件的日期将被删除。
七、使用条件格式删除日期
1、选择包含日期的列或区域
选择包含日期的列或区域,然后点击Excel菜单栏中的“开始”选项卡,找到“条件格式”功能并点击。
2、设置条件格式
在条件格式菜单中选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入=ISNUMBER(A1),并设置单元格格式为隐藏或白色字体。
3、应用条件格式
点击“确定”应用条件格式。此时,符合条件的日期将变为隐藏或白色字体,虽然内容仍在单元格中,但不会显示。
八、使用Power Query删除日期
1、加载数据到Power Query
选择包含日期的表格或区域,然后点击Excel菜单栏中的“数据”选项卡,选择“从表格/范围”加载数据到Power Query编辑器。
2、删除日期列
在Power Query编辑器中,选择包含日期的列,然后右键点击选择“删除列”。删除日期列后,点击“关闭并加载”将数据返回到Excel工作表。
总结
在Excel中删除日期有多种方法,根据具体需求选择适合的方法。直接删除单元格内容、使用查找和替换功能、利用文本到列功能、使用公式删除日期、使用VBA宏删除日期、使用筛选功能删除日期、使用条件格式删除日期、使用Power Query删除日期,这些方法可以帮助你高效地删除Excel中的日期数据。根据工作表的复杂程度和数据量,选择最适合的方法将大大提高工作效率。
相关问答FAQs:
1. 如何在Excel中删除日期?
在Excel中删除日期非常简单。只需选择包含日期的单元格或单元格范围,然后按下“Delete”键或右键单击并选择“删除”选项即可删除日期。
2. 怎样删除Excel表格中的某一天的日期?
如果你只想删除Excel表格中的某一天日期,可以使用筛选功能。首先,选择包含日期的列标题,然后点击“数据”选项卡上的“筛选”按钮。在日期列的筛选器中,选择不包含所需日期的选项,然后单击“确定”以删除该日期。
3. 如何删除Excel工作表中的所有日期?
如果你想删除整个Excel工作表中的所有日期,可以使用查找和替换功能。首先,按下Ctrl + F打开查找和替换对话框。在“查找”框中输入“*”(星号),在“替换”框中留空,然后点击“替换所有”按钮。这将删除所有日期并保留其他数据。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4524333